  • Patent number: 12569328
    Abstract: A system for transvascular delivery to an aortic arch of a patient includes an embolic protection device, a connector mechanism, and a catheter or sheath for delivering the embolic protection device to a working zone. The embolic protection device includes a support frame having a distal portion and a proximal portion, and a filter member attached to the support frame and configured for preventing embolic materials from passing there through. At least one of the distal portion and the proximal portion includes a spring section configured for providing a radial force between the support frame and a wall of the aortic arch when in an expanded state. The embolic protection device is pivotable axially but not radially relative to the connector mechanism.

  • Patent number: 12186500
    Abstract: An introducer sheath assembly having a handle portion including a distal end and a proximal end, and an introducer sheath extending outwardly from the distal end of the handle portion, the introducer sheath including a device lumen configured to slidably receive a corresponding device, a guidewire lumen configured to slidably receive a corresponding guidewire, and at least one steering cable disposed within at least one steering cable lumens that are disposed radially outwardly from the device lumen, and the handle portion including at least one steering assembly for modifying the tension of at least one of the at least one steering cables.

  • Patent number: 10500033
    Abstract: In general, the invention features an intra-vascular device for filtering or deflecting emboli or other large objects from entering a protected secondary vessel or vessels. The device of the invention may include a filter, an central member, additional supporting members, and a delivery cable and may serve to filter or deflect emboli or other large objects from entering protected secondary vessels. The device may be capable of collapse along its longitudinal axis for ease of delivery to the treatment site. The device may further be compatible with common delivery methods used in interventional cardiology (e.g., TAVI procedures). The device may be integrated into the delivery systems. In other embodiments the device may be detachable from the delivery system. Upon deployment, the device may be positioned so as to contact the orifice of one or more secondary blood vessels. Upon retrieval the device may be retracted in an orientation substantially similar to the original deployment orientation.
